Grindstone Running Festival by UTMB
The Grindstone Running Festival by UTMB is a trail running event held 17 to 20 September 2026 at Natural Chimneys Park, Virginia. The course runs through acres of national forest just west of the Shenandoah Valley and includes miles inside the George Washington and Jefferson National Forest.
Runners encounter Appalachian ridges, peaks, and valleys on largely technical terrain with significant elevation gain. The event is set during peak fall foliage and offers repeated ridge and mountain views along the trails.
The festival offers four distance options:
- 100M: 167.4 km; 6400 m+ elevation; 4 Running Stones
- 100K: 100 km; 3350 m+ elevation; 3 Running Stones
- 50K: 50 km; 1550 m+ elevation; 2 Running Stones
- 21K: 21 km; 500 m+ elevation; 1 Running Stone
Grindstone is a dual qualifier for the UTMB World Series Finals and the Western States Endurance Run. UTMB Community Bibs are available; half of those registration proceeds support a local charity chosen by the race team and the program is part of IRONMAN Foundation charitable giveback efforts.
